What is Culvert Rating

The Culvert Rating Form is a government document used by inspectors to assess the condition and load rating of culverts.

What is the Culvert Rating Form?

The Culvert Rating Form serves a crucial role in assessing the condition of culverts within infrastructure projects. This form is essential for determining the load capacity and ongoing maintenance needs of various culverts. It prompts users to gather essential data, ensuring accurate evaluations.

Purpose and Benefits of the Culvert Rating Form

Understanding the necessity of the Culvert Rating Form is vital for infrastructure safety and strategic planning. This form is beneficial for government agencies, contractors, and engineers by facilitating rigorous assessments that enhance public safety. Benefits include:
  • Standardized evaluation of culvert conditions.
  • Informed decision-making for maintenance and repairs.
  • Documentation for compliance and reporting purposes.

Key Features of the Culvert Rating Form

The form includes various components, such as fillable fields, rating guidelines, and specific criteria for evaluation. Important aspects include:
  • Sections for bridge details, such as 'Bridge Number' and 'Year Built'.
  • Guidelines that assist in determining load ratings.
  • Instructions that advise on using alternative forms for certain condition ratings.
This information directly influences load rating assessments and essential maintenance planning.

If the condition rating is 4 or less, do not use the Culvert Rating Form. Instead, utilize the Physical Inspection Rating form to provide a more detailed assessment.
